White Co. Schools Selected For Special Education Initiative

The White County School System is one of 18 Tennessee schools selected for the state’s new Teaching All Students Initiative. The program is meant to strengthen instruction for students with significant cognitive disabilities. White Co. Schools Exploring Building Projects With Incoming COVID Funds

The White County School System looks to complete two capital projects with an expected $3.9 million in COVID funds on the way. Replacing the White County Middle School rooftop and a proposed expansion of Bon De Croft Elementary are two priorities.
